function पर टैग किए गए जवाब

एक फ़ंक्शन (जिसे एक प्रक्रिया, विधि, सबरूटीन या रूटीन भी कहा जाता है) एक एकल, विशिष्ट कार्य को करने के लिए इच्छित कोड का एक हिस्सा है। इस टैग का उपयोग उन सवालों के लिए करें जिनमें विशेष रूप से कार्य करना या कॉल करना शामिल है। किसी कार्य को करने के लिए किसी फ़ंक्शन को कार्यान्वित करने में सहायता के लिए, इसके बजाय [एल्गोरिथ्म] या कार्य-विशिष्ट टैग का उपयोग करें।

30
जावास्क्रिप्ट क्लोजर कैसे काम करता है?
इस प्रश्न के उत्तर सामुदायिक प्रयास हैं । इस पोस्ट को बेहतर बनाने के लिए मौजूदा उत्तरों को संपादित करें। यह वर्तमान में नए उत्तरों या इंटरैक्शन को स्वीकार नहीं कर रहा है। На сттот вопрос есть ответы на Stack Overflow на русском : Как работают замыкания в JavaScript आप …

30
var फ़ंक्शन नाम = फ़ंक्शन () {} बनाम फ़ंक्शन फ़ंक्शन नाम () {}
मैंने हाल ही में किसी और के जावास्क्रिप्ट कोड को बनाए रखना शुरू किया है। मैं बग को ठीक कर रहा हूं, सुविधाओं को जोड़ रहा हूं और कोड को साफ करने और इसे अधिक सुसंगत बनाने की कोशिश कर रहा हूं। पिछले डेवलपर ने फ़ंक्शंस घोषित करने के दो …

21
कॉल और अप्लाई के बीच क्या अंतर है?
किसी फ़ंक्शन का उपयोग करने callऔर applyउसे लागू करने के बीच क्या अंतर है? var func = function() { alert('hello!'); }; func.apply(); बनाम func.call(); क्या दो पूर्वोक्त विधियों के बीच प्रदर्शन अंतर हैं? callओवर applyऔर इसके विपरीत का उपयोग कब करना सबसे अच्छा है ?

26
जावास्क्रिप्ट फ़ंक्शन के लिए एक डिफ़ॉल्ट पैरामीटर मान सेट करें
मैं चाहूंगा कि एक जावास्क्रिप्ट फ़ंक्शन के पास वैकल्पिक तर्क हों, जिन पर मैंने एक डिफ़ॉल्ट सेट किया है, जो कि अगर मूल्य परिभाषित नहीं किया जाता है (और यदि मूल्य पारित हो गया है तो इसे नजरअंदाज कर दिया जाता है)। रूबी में आप इसे इस तरह कर सकते …

26
जावास्क्रिप्ट में चर का दायरा क्या है?
जावास्क्रिप्ट में चर का दायरा क्या है? क्या उनके पास एक कार्यक्षेत्र के बाहर समान विरोध है? या इससे भी फर्क पड़ता है? इसके अलावा, यदि विश्व स्तर पर परिभाषित किया गया है, तो चर कहाँ संग्रहीत किए जाते हैं?



26
पाइथन लैंबडास उपयोगी क्यों हैं? [बन्द है]
बंद हो गया । इस प्रश्न पर अधिक ध्यान देने की आवश्यकता है । यह वर्तमान में उत्तर स्वीकार नहीं कर रहा है। इस प्रश्न को सुधारना चाहते हैं? प्रश्न को अपडेट करें ताकि यह इस पोस्ट को संपादित करके केवल एक समस्या पर केंद्रित हो । 4 साल पहले …

3
फ़ंक्शन अभिव्यक्ति के सामने जावास्क्रिप्ट प्लस साइन
मैं तुरंत लागू किए गए कार्यों के बारे में जानकारी ढूंढ रहा हूं, और कहीं न कहीं मैं इस अंकन पर अड़ गया हूं: +function(){console.log("Something.")}() क्या कोई मुझे समझा सकता +है कि फ़ंक्शन के सामने संकेत का क्या अर्थ है / करता है?

11
'क्लोजर' और 'लैम्ब्डा' में क्या अंतर है?
कोई समझा सकता है? मैं उनके पीछे की मूल अवधारणाओं को समझता हूं, लेकिन मैं अक्सर उन्हें परस्पर उपयोग करते हुए देखता हूं और मैं भ्रमित हो जाता हूं। और अब जब हम यहाँ हैं, तो वे एक नियमित कार्य से कैसे भिन्न हैं?

21
जावास्क्रिप्ट कॉल () और लागू () बनाम बाइंड ()?
मुझे पहले से ही पता है applyऔरcall समान कार्य हैं जो सेट this(एक फ़ंक्शन का संदर्भ) हैं। अंतर हम तर्क भेजने के तरीके के साथ है (मैनुअल बनाम सरणी) सवाल: लेकिन मुझे bind()विधि का उपयोग कब करना चाहिए ? var obj = { x: 81, getX: function() { return this.x; …

13
चर और फ़ंक्शन नामों के लिए पायथन में नामकरण सम्मेलन क्या है?
C # बैकग्राउंड से आने वाला नामकरण कन्वेंशन चर और विधि के नाम के लिए होता है, जो आमतौर पर कैमलकेस या पास्कलकेस होता है: // C# example string thisIsMyVariable = "a" public void ThisIsMyMethod() पायथन में, मैंने ऊपर देखा है, लेकिन मैंने अंडरस्कोर का उपयोग भी देखा है: # …

11
स्ट्रिंग के रूप में एक फ़ंक्शन नाम कैसे प्राप्त करें?
पायथन में, मुझे फ़ंक्शन को कॉल किए बिना, स्ट्रिंग के रूप में एक फ़ंक्शन नाम कैसे मिलता है? def my_function(): pass print get_function_name_as_string(my_function) # my_function is not in quotes आउटपुट चाहिए "my_function"। क्या पायथन में ऐसा कार्य उपलब्ध है? यदि नहीं, तो get_function_name_as_stringपायथन में कैसे लागू करने के बारे में …
740 python  string  function 

13
पैरामीटर के रूप में एक जावास्क्रिप्ट फ़ंक्शन पास करें
मैं "पैरेंट" फ़ंक्शन में निष्पादित या उपयोग किए बिना फ़ंक्शन के पैरामीटर के रूप में फ़ंक्शन कैसे पास करूं eval()? (जब से मैंने पढ़ा है कि यह असुरक्षित है।) मेरे पास यह है: addContact(entityId, refreshContactList()); यह काम करता है, लेकिन समस्या यह है कि refreshContactListजब फ़ंक्शन का उपयोग किया जाता …


ह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.